The Fall Line is the boundary in the eastern US that marks the place where higher land drops to the lower coastal plain. It is a transition zone where the harder, resistant rocks of the Piedmont region meet the softer sediments of the coastal plain, resulting in waterfalls and rapids. The Fall Line also played a significant role in the location of early settlements and industries.
